Output 66c3feead2613c2f5c32f84f6dc5fe7f0ce927b20d57bdd8ee0f6904783eb345:1

value
633520
script pubkey
OP_0 OP_PUSHBYTES_20 4148a0c186ca2185853f07d6ad979961dfde69e4
address
ltc1qg9y2psvxegsctpflqlt2m9uev80au60yvk2exj
transaction
66c3feead2613c2f5c32f84f6dc5fe7f0ce927b20d57bdd8ee0f6904783eb345
spent
true